ADELPHI, Md. -- An Army scientist recently won a best paper award at the Association for Computing Machinery's 26th Conference on User Modeling, Adaptation and Personalization for discovering that most people cannot distinguish between liking a user interface and making good choices.

Dr. James Schaffer, U.S. Army Research Laboratory scientist stationed at ARL West, and his collaborators at the University of California, Santa Barbara, Drs. John O'Donovan and Tobias Höllerer, received the best paper award at the conference held in July at Nanyang Technological University in Singapore.

So, does technology really enhance our decision-making ability?

The paper, "Separating User Experience from Choice Satisfaction," addresses this question and furthers the theory that underpins the evaluation of recommender systems, which are designed to help users make good choices.

Simply put, recommender systems are artificially intelligent algorithms that use big data to suggest additional products to consumers based off of things such as past purchases, demographic information or search history, for example. Think of the "people you may know" feature that exists on many of today's social media platforms.

In recommender systems, it has been assumed that users form very complex mental models of user interfaces.

This is reflected in current user experience measurements, which elicit subjective responses on a wide range of system features.  .... "

Value Delivery Modelling Language
Value Delivery Modeling Language (VDML) is a standard modeling language for analysis and design of the operation of an enterprise with particular focus on the creation and exchange of value.

In 2009, the Object Management Group (OMG) launched a Request for Proposal (RfP) to develop a standard for value modeling. The goal of this RfP is to integrate the different existing value models and give a complete overview of the business logic of an organisation. To reach this goal, the standard has to satisfy nine requirements .... "

MIT News (08/10/16) Larry Hardesty

Researchers from the Massachusetts Institute of Technology's (MIT) Computer Science and Artificial Intelligence Laboratory, Adobe, the University of California, Berkeley, the University of Toronto, Texas A&M University, and the University of Texas have developed a programming language called Simit. Simit can accelerate computer simulations by a factor of 200 or reduce their required code by 90 percent, according to a paper the researchers presented last month at the ACM SIGGRAPH 2016 conference in Anaheim, CA. 

"The story of this paper is that the trade-off between concise code and good performance is false," says MIT graduate student Fredrik Kjolstad. "It's not necessary, at least for the problems that this applies to. But it applies to a large class of problems." Simit requires the programmer to describe the translation between the graphical description of a system and the matrix description, but following that the coder can use the language of linear algebra to program the simulation. 

During the simulation, Simit does not have to translate graphs into matrices and vice versa, instead converting instructions issued in the language of linear algebra into the language of graphs, keeping the runtime efficiency of hand-coded simulations. Kjolstad notes Simit-written programs can run on either conventional microprocessors or on graphics processing units with no underlying code revisions.

" ... This study compares the accuracy of personality judgment—a ubiquitous and important social-cognitive activity—between computer models and humans. Using several criteria, we show that computers’ judgments of people’s personalities based on their digital footprints are more accurate and valid than judgments made by their close others or acquaintances (friends, family, spouse, colleagues, etc.). Our findings highlight that people’s personalities can be predicted automatically and without involving human social-cognitive skills. ...  "

Interactive Intent Modeling: Information Discovery Beyond Search
Combining intent modeling and visual user interfaces can help users discover novel information and dramatically improve their information-exploration performance. .. "

" ... We introduce interactive intent modeling, an approach promoting resourceful interaction between humans and IR systems to enable information discovery that goes beyond search. It addresses the vocabulary mismatch problem by giving users potential intents to explore, visualizing them as directions in the information space around the user's present position, and allowing interaction to improve estimates of the user's search intents. ...
